Hi All,

The aquarium stores in my area are pretty poor for aquascaping equipment and materials. Getting decent substrate and rock is near on impossible.

I have found good types of rock for sale online, one of which is dragon stone which has caught my eye. The issue with buying online is you dont know what you are getting. They are advertised as 10kg and 20kg boxes. I have no idea how much that is in terms of filling your tank for an Iwagumi.

I will be scaping a 60x45x30 (Same tank as George Farmer's current work)

Anyone know whether 10kg is enough?

Im also guessing that I will have to ask for a varied range of heights and sizes :-/
 
It depends what sort of scape you have in mind, and how fussy you are. 10kg will just do it for an "average" scape, but if you're intending to either do a mostly hardscape scape, or are fussy about picking out particular stones, you'll be better off getting 20kg.

if its andy aquatics that youve seen the 10kg and 20kg stones in then it will be varied in the box. the 10Kg is used to be made by splitting a 20kg so its the same stones. I used a 20Kg and some existing to do my 90cm in the avatar pic. probably about 30Kg in total.
